| At the most fundamental level, a story has 2 components: Someone WAnts something (Desire) There are obstacles (Conflict) A story requires a conscious hero... story is bigger than cause -> effect. Science looks for cause -> guaranteed effect. Stories are Cause -> Human Decision/Doubt/Excuses... Commitment -> Effect. The powerful part of a story is how the human (or humanised entity) discovers greater strength than previously imagined... what is interesting in the story is how the human changed though the process.
